US President Trump: Iran’s New Regime President asked for a ceasefire

In a post published on Truth Social on Wednesday, United States (US) President Donald Trump said that Iran’s New Regime President, who is "much less radicalized and far more intelligent than his predecessors," has asked the US for a ceasefire.

"We will consider when Hormuz Strait is open, free, and clear. Until then, we are blasting Iran into oblivion or, as they say, back to the Stone Ages," he added.

Market reaction

US stock index futures stay in positive territory and the US Dollar (USD) Index stays close to daily lows near 99.50. As of writing, Dow Futures were up 0.5%, while the Nasdaq Futures were gaining 0.8%.

Oil: War risk keeps prices elevated – Rabobank

RaboBank's Global Strategist Michael Every highlights that Gulf War 3 and the closure of the Strait of Hormuz have pushed Oil prices about 60% above pre-war levels, with specific products like diesel and jet fuel particularly affected in Asia.
